Research into the safe and effective application of energy devices in thoracic surgery highlights the importance of a systematic approach. Considering the potential for collateral thermal injury and other complications, which of the following best represents the operative principle for energy device utilization during a complex lung resection?
Correct
This scenario presents a professional challenge due to the inherent risks associated with energy device use in thoracic surgery, particularly in the Indo-Pacific region where surgical techniques and device availability may vary. Ensuring patient safety and optimal surgical outcomes requires a meticulous understanding of operative principles, appropriate instrumentation, and stringent adherence to energy device safety protocols. The challenge lies in balancing the benefits of energy devices (e.g., haemostasis, dissection) with the potential for collateral thermal injury, nerve damage, or fire. Careful judgment is required to select the most appropriate energy device and settings for the specific surgical task and patient anatomy, while also anticipating and mitigating potential complications. The best professional practice involves a comprehensive pre-operative assessment and intra-operative vigilance. This includes confirming the correct energy device is selected for the specific surgical task, verifying its functionality and settings with the surgical team, and ensuring appropriate safety measures are in place, such as adequate insulation of instruments and the presence of a fire extinguisher. Furthermore, continuous monitoring of tissue response and prompt adjustment of energy delivery are crucial. This approach aligns with the fundamental ethical principle of non-maleficence (do no harm) and the professional responsibility to maintain competence and provide the highest standard of care. Regulatory guidelines, such as those promoted by surgical associations and device manufacturers, emphasize a systematic approach to energy device safety, including pre-use checks and team communication. An incorrect approach would be to assume the device is functioning optimally without verification. This overlooks the critical need for pre-operative checks and team communication, potentially leading to misapplication of energy, unintended tissue damage, or even surgical fires. Ethically, this demonstrates a lapse in due diligence and a failure to uphold the duty of care. Another incorrect approach is to rely solely on the surgeon’s experience without considering the specific characteristics of the energy device or the operative field. While experience is valuable, it should not replace systematic safety checks and adherence to established protocols. This can lead to overlooking subtle device malfunctions or inappropriate energy application, violating the principle of prudence and potentially causing harm. A further incorrect approach is to neglect the use of appropriate insulation or safety measures, such as failing to ensure all active electrode surfaces are visible and insulated. This significantly increases the risk of unintended electrical current delivery to adjacent tissues or structures, leading to thermal injury or nerve damage. This directly contravenes established safety guidelines and the ethical imperative to minimize patient risk. The professional reasoning process for similar situations should involve a structured, multi-step approach: 1. Thorough pre-operative planning, including review of patient anatomy and the specific surgical procedure. 2. Confirmation of the correct energy device and accessories for the planned dissection or haemostasis. 3. Mandatory pre-use verification of the device’s functionality and settings by the entire surgical team. 4. Implementation of all recommended safety precautions, including insulation checks and fire preparedness. 5. Continuous intra-operative assessment of tissue response and prompt adjustment of energy delivery. 6. Open communication within the surgical team regarding energy device use and any observed anomalies.

Compliance review shows a patient presenting to the emergency department with severe chest trauma following an accident. The patient is hypotensive, tachycardic, and exhibiting signs of respiratory distress. Considering the patient’s history of thoracic oncology surgery, what is the most appropriate initial approach to resuscitation and management?
Correct
Scenario Analysis: This scenario is professionally challenging due to the inherent urgency and potential for rapid deterioration in a trauma patient requiring critical care and resuscitation. The need to balance immediate life-saving interventions with established protocols, especially in a complex Indo-Pacific thoracic oncology surgery context where pre-existing conditions or surgical sequelae might complicate resuscitation, demands precise and evidence-based decision-making. The pressure to act swiftly while adhering to best practices and regulatory guidelines is paramount. Correct Approach Analysis: The best professional practice involves initiating a structured, evidence-based resuscitation protocol that prioritizes airway, breathing, and circulation (ABCDE approach), while simultaneously obtaining a focused history and performing a rapid physical examination. This approach is correct because it aligns with universally accepted trauma resuscitation guidelines, such as those promoted by the Advanced Trauma Life Support (ATLS) program, which are foundational in critical care and trauma management globally. This systematic method ensures that life-threatening conditions are addressed in order of priority, minimizing the risk of overlooking critical injuries or initiating inappropriate interventions. Regulatory frameworks in most advanced healthcare systems emphasize adherence to such standardized protocols to ensure patient safety and quality of care. Ethically, this approach upholds the principle of beneficence by acting in the patient’s best interest through a comprehensive and prioritized assessment. Incorrect Approaches Analysis: Initiating aggressive fluid resuscitation without a clear assessment of the airway and breathing status is professionally unacceptable. This failure neglects the primary ABCDE priorities, potentially exacerbating respiratory compromise or masking underlying airway issues, which is a direct contravention of established resuscitation protocols and patient safety principles. Delaying definitive airway management to focus solely on obtaining a complete past medical history from the patient or family is also professionally unacceptable. While history is important, in a critical trauma scenario, immediate life-saving interventions for airway patency and adequate ventilation take precedence over detailed historical data collection. This approach violates the urgency dictated by the ABCDE assessment and risks irreversible harm due to hypoxia. Administering broad-spectrum antibiotics and analgesia before assessing hemodynamic stability and initiating basic resuscitation measures is professionally unacceptable. While infection control and pain management are crucial aspects of patient care, they are secondary to immediate life support. This approach deviates from the prioritized resuscitation sequence and could delay critical interventions, potentially leading to adverse outcomes. Professional Reasoning: Professionals should employ a systematic, protocol-driven approach to trauma resuscitation. This involves a rapid, sequential assessment using the ABCDE framework, followed by targeted interventions. Continuous reassessment is critical. In situations involving thoracic oncology patients, awareness of potential pre-existing conditions or surgical complications that might influence resuscitation (e.g., pleural effusions, compromised lung function) is essential, but these considerations should be integrated within the established resuscitation framework, not used as a reason to deviate from its core principles. Adherence to evidence-based guidelines and institutional protocols ensures a consistent and effective standard of care.

Analysis of a scenario where an advanced practice nurse caring for a patient awaiting thoracic surgery notes the patient expresses significant anxiety and a desire to refuse the procedure, despite the surgical team’s consensus that the surgery is medically indicated and offers the best chance of recovery. The patient’s family is also expressing concern about the patient’s mental state, suggesting they are not thinking clearly. What is the most appropriate course of action for the advanced practice nurse?
Correct
This scenario presents a professional challenge rooted in the advanced practice nurse’s responsibility to advocate for patient autonomy and informed consent, particularly when a patient’s capacity to make decisions is in question. The complexity arises from balancing the patient’s right to refuse treatment with the perceived best interests of the patient and the legal/ethical obligations of the healthcare team. Careful judgment is required to navigate the nuanced assessment of capacity and the appropriate escalation of care. The best professional approach involves a systematic and collaborative assessment of the patient’s decision-making capacity. This entails engaging the patient in a dialogue to understand their reasoning, assessing their comprehension of the proposed treatment and its alternatives, and evaluating their ability to weigh the risks and benefits. If capacity is deemed to be impaired, the next crucial step is to involve the multidisciplinary team, including the attending thoracic surgeon and potentially a geriatric psychiatrist or ethics consultant, to conduct a formal capacity assessment and discuss surrogate decision-making options in accordance with established ethical guidelines and relevant legal frameworks governing patient rights and substituted decision-making. This approach upholds patient dignity, ensures a thorough evaluation, and promotes shared decision-making among the healthcare team and the patient’s legal representatives if necessary. An incorrect approach would be to proceed with the surgery based solely on the surgeon’s opinion that it is in the patient’s best interest, without a formal capacity assessment or discussion with the patient or their designated surrogate. This disregards the fundamental ethical principle of patient autonomy and the legal requirement for informed consent. It also fails to acknowledge the potential for reversible causes of impaired capacity. Another professionally unacceptable approach would be to unilaterally decide to proceed with surgery, overriding the patient’s expressed wishes, even if those wishes are perceived as detrimental. This constitutes a paternalistic intervention that violates the patient’s right to self-determination and can lead to significant ethical and legal repercussions. Furthermore, delaying the surgical intervention indefinitely due to a perceived lack of capacity, without initiating a formal assessment process or exploring alternative management strategies, is also inappropriate. This inaction can lead to patient harm if the condition is progressive and requires timely treatment. It fails to actively manage the patient’s care and address the underlying issues affecting their decision-making. Professionals should employ a decision-making framework that prioritizes patient-centered care. This involves: 1) Initial assessment of the patient’s understanding and expressed wishes. 2) If concerns about capacity arise, conduct a thorough, non-coercive assessment of decision-making abilities. 3) Engage the multidisciplinary team for consultation and collaborative decision-making. 4) If capacity is impaired, identify and involve the appropriate surrogate decision-maker according to legal and ethical protocols. 5) Document all assessments, discussions, and decisions meticulously.

Consider a scenario where a complex thoracic oncology surgery is scheduled, involving a large, centrally located tumor with potential involvement of major vascular structures. What approach to structured operative planning and risk mitigation would best ensure optimal patient outcomes and team preparedness?
Correct
Scenario Analysis: This scenario presents a significant professional challenge due to the inherent complexity of thoracic oncology surgery, the potential for unforeseen intraoperative events, and the critical need for patient safety. Structured operative planning with robust risk mitigation is paramount to navigating these complexities. The challenge lies in balancing comprehensive preparation with the dynamic nature of surgery, ensuring that the plan is both detailed enough to guide the team and flexible enough to adapt to unexpected findings or complications. Failure to adequately plan and mitigate risks can lead to adverse patient outcomes, increased morbidity, and potential legal or ethical repercussions. Correct Approach Analysis: The best professional practice involves a multi-faceted approach that begins with a thorough pre-operative assessment and extends to detailed intraoperative contingency planning. This includes a comprehensive review of imaging, pathology, and patient comorbidities to anticipate potential challenges. Crucially, it necessitates a structured discussion with the entire surgical team, including anaesthetists, nurses, and technicians, to identify potential risks and collaboratively develop specific mitigation strategies. This collaborative risk assessment should cover anticipated technical difficulties, potential for bleeding, airway compromise, and the availability of necessary equipment and blood products. The plan should also include clear communication protocols for intraoperative decision-making and escalation. This approach aligns with ethical principles of beneficence and non-maleficence, ensuring that all reasonable steps are taken to maximize patient benefit and minimize harm. It also reflects professional standards of care that mandate thorough preparation and team-based decision-making in complex surgical procedures. Incorrect Approaches Analysis: Relying solely on the surgeon’s extensive experience without explicit team-wide risk identification and mitigation planning is professionally unacceptable. While experience is invaluable, it does not negate the need for structured communication and collaborative problem-solving. This approach risks overlooking potential issues that a junior team member might identify or failing to ensure all team members are aware of and prepared for specific contingencies. This can lead to communication breakdowns and delayed responses during critical moments, violating the principle of non-maleficence. Adopting a rigid, inflexible operative plan that does not account for potential intraoperative deviations is also professionally unsound. Surgery is inherently unpredictable. A plan that cannot be adapted based on intraoperative findings, such as unexpected tumor extent or anatomical variations, can lead to suboptimal patient care or necessitate emergency measures that carry higher risks. This approach fails to uphold the principle of beneficence by not optimizing the surgical outcome based on real-time information. Focusing exclusively on the technical aspects of the surgery while neglecting anaesthetic and post-operative care planning represents a fragmented approach. Thoracic oncology surgery requires a holistic view of patient management. Failure to integrate anaesthetic considerations (e.g., ventilation strategies, haemodynamic management) and post-operative care (e.g., pain management, respiratory physiotherapy, ICU requirements) into the overall operative plan can lead to significant complications and compromise patient recovery. This oversight can be seen as a failure to provide comprehensive care, potentially violating ethical obligations to the patient. Professional Reasoning: Professionals should adopt a systematic, team-based approach to operative planning. This involves: 1. Comprehensive Pre-operative Assessment: Thoroughly review all patient data, imaging, and pathology. 2. Collaborative Risk Identification: Engage the entire surgical team in identifying potential risks and challenges. 3. Structured Mitigation Strategies: Develop specific plans to address identified risks, including contingency measures. 4. Clear Communication Protocols: Establish clear lines of communication and decision-making processes for the operative period. 5. Flexibility and Adaptability: Build in mechanisms for adapting the plan based on intraoperative findings. 6. Integrated Care Planning: Ensure that anaesthetic and post-operative care are integral parts of the operative plan.

Strategic planning requires advanced practice clinicians in thoracic oncology surgery to anticipate and manage complex ethical and clinical dilemmas. Consider an APC who is called to manage a patient in the operating room requiring an immediate, life-saving thoracic procedure due to sudden hemodynamic instability. The patient is intubated and sedated, and their family is not immediately available. The APC recognizes that delaying the procedure to obtain formal informed consent would significantly increase the patient’s risk of mortality. What is the most appropriate course of action for the APC?
Correct
Scenario Analysis: This scenario presents a common challenge in advanced practice in thoracic oncology surgery: balancing the immediate need for patient care with the imperative of adhering to established ethical and professional guidelines regarding informed consent and the scope of practice. The advanced practice clinician (APC) is faced with a situation where a patient requires urgent intervention, but the standard consent process has not been fully completed due to time constraints and the patient’s condition. This creates a tension between beneficence (acting in the patient’s best interest) and autonomy (respecting the patient’s right to make informed decisions). The professional challenge lies in navigating this ethical tightrope without compromising patient safety, legal standing, or professional integrity. Correct Approach Analysis: The correct approach involves proceeding with the necessary urgent intervention while simultaneously initiating the process to obtain informed consent as soon as the patient’s condition permits. This means performing the life-saving procedure, as the delay in obtaining full consent is outweighed by the immediate threat to life or limb. Concurrently, the APC must document the emergent nature of the situation and the rationale for proceeding. As soon as the patient is stable enough, a comprehensive discussion about the procedure, its risks, benefits, and alternatives must occur, and formal consent obtained retrospectively. This approach prioritizes patient safety and life preservation while upholding the principle of informed consent as a continuous process, acknowledging that in emergencies, the order of operations may be adjusted to preserve life, with subsequent formalization of consent. This aligns with ethical principles of beneficence and non-maleficence, and the legal framework that often allows for implied consent in life-threatening emergencies, provided it is followed by explicit consent when possible. Incorrect Approaches Analysis: Proceeding with the urgent intervention without any attempt to obtain consent, even retrospectively, is ethically and legally problematic. While the emergency may justify immediate action, the absence of any subsequent consent process fails to respect patient autonomy and could lead to legal challenges regarding battery. Delaying the urgent intervention until full consent is obtained, despite the patient’s critical condition, would be a failure of the duty of care and a violation of the principle of beneficence, potentially leading to irreversible harm or death. Obtaining consent from a family member without assessing the patient’s capacity or the existence of an advance directive, and without documenting the emergent circumstances, bypasses the patient’s autonomy and may not be legally valid if the patient is capable of making their own decisions. Professional Reasoning: Professionals in this situation should employ a framework that prioritizes patient safety and ethical adherence. This involves: 1) Rapid assessment of the patient’s condition and the urgency of the intervention. 2) Identification of any immediate barriers to obtaining informed consent (e.g., patient’s unconsciousness, severe distress). 3) If the situation is life-threatening and consent cannot be obtained, proceed with the necessary intervention to preserve life, meticulously documenting the emergent circumstances and the rationale. 4) As soon as the patient’s condition stabilizes, initiate the full informed consent process, explaining the procedure performed, its necessity, and obtaining retrospective consent. 5) If there is any doubt about the patient’s capacity, explore options for surrogate decision-making in accordance with established legal and ethical protocols.
